My wife's grandfather gave me his vintage Walker Tuner 900 Series Drill Press when he shut down his shop. It was in good working condition when I took ownership. I've had it in storage for about 8-10 years and would like to put it back in service, but I'm in over my head on the wiring. The plug on it appears to be for 220v 30amp service (though, I'm not certain about that). I have a standard 120v outlet available. The junction box on the drill press has a diagram that shows both 220v and 110v wiring configurations. Neither seem to match what I'm seeing inside. Most of the wires have turned a dingy yellow/brown color, so it's hard to discern what's what. I'm also concerned about the condition of the wires (cracked sheathing) and possible safety issues there.

Any suggestions on how to get this back up and running? Should I hire an electrician? Are there people who specialize in tool/appliance wiring? Any recommendations for someone who might be local to the SF Bay Area? Any help is appreciated.

You might have better luck with a handyman, an electrician might get a bit expensive around here. It seems like I can see a red wire coming out of the body, so it should be connected to the yellow.

The wires connected to the cord should be easy too.

Putting an ohm meter on each pair of wires from the 220v diagram should tell you about shorts inside the motor.

The plug is a NEMA 6-15, which should be 220v.

It can only be wired two ways, so you should be able to determine colors by the way it is wired now. There may be a little color left underneath the wirenuts.

Determine how it is jumpered and you can use colored electric tape to mark them and change it to 120.

My personal opinion, if the insulation cracks, put a good wrap of 33 electrical tape on it, and as long as the frame is grounded, run it. If the insulation in the motor is shot, the whole motor is trash.

You have two options. You can replace the motor, which is very easy on a W-T 900, or you can check the wiring on the motor that is on there, see how it is wired up (either in series or in parallel, as per the plate), and then procede to wire it the way you would like it.

Neither of these would be too hard, but the first option is easier as long as you have a motor to use, and, as motors burn out and get replaced all the time, it wouldn't be too uncommon to find an unoriginal motor attached. My 900 has a GE motor, and it works great while looking period perfect.

RTM is right, the plug is for 220, and I would bet that it is wired that way. I wouldn't be too hard to mark each wire with painters tape to show the current connections, and then use an ohm meter to check for continuity and too make sure that the diagram is being followed if you are switching to 120vac.

Faded colors on the older fabric covered wires can be a problem. Walker Turner used pretty much the same convention as Delta for their motor coil wires.

Delta motor connections.jpg

If you have a continuity tester, narrowing down the colors can be easier.
Black and red are opposite ends of one coil.
Yellow and green are opposite ends of the other coil.
The coils are in parallel for what is labelled 110 volts of your junction box cover (typically 120 VAC now).
The coils are in series for what you have labeled 220 volts, (typically 240 VAC now).
Once you mark the wires in some way and disconnect the coils, use the ohmmeter or continuity tester to see which is what.
Red tends to fade to yellowish. Green can look like black. If one wire looks reddish, the other end should be black and so forth.

Great progress here. I used WillyBoy's suggestion to check continuity and was able to figure out the colors for each wire (I had red/yellow mixed up). I got a new power cable and connected it directly to the motor using the wiring diagram. I bypassed the switch just to see if it would come to life. And it turned right on. Now I need to see if I can figure out how the switch factors into this jumble of wires. I may come back with another question on that. Thank you all for your help.

Be sure to check that the centrifugal switch operates smoothly with a good "clack" . The motor turns, so it works, but may get sticky not working for a long time. If you ever turn it on and it just hums, turn it off immediately. Have fun!

For 120VAC operation, you only need to break one side of the line. Put the switch in series with the black lead going to either the black/yellow connection or the red/green connection. The common (white) can go to the other connection. Connect the ground to a screw on the motor or on the junction box.

Thank you to everyone who offered some advice here. The rewiring is complete and the drill press is running again.

Quick summary of how this landed in case it's helpful for anyone in the future...
  • Checked continuity on motor wires to confirm red/green and black/yellow pairs and labeled each.
  • Got some fresh 12AWG power cable and installed new 120VAC plug.
  • Tested motor by connecting black AC wire to red/green pair and white AC wire to black/yellow pair (no switch).
  • Added the switch using a short section of 12AWG cable. Only need to use one side of the switch!
  • Stuffed it all back in the junction box and grounded the power cable to the junction box.
